Latest Patents

McConville holds a patent for a process titled "Process of forming and modifying particles and compositions produced thereby." This invention relates to methods for forming particles, including drugs in a solution, and modifying their properties. The process utilizes mechanical agitation, specifically low-frequency sonication, to control particle growth and mixing properties. The particle size can vary significantly, ranging from less than about 200 nanometers to greater than one millimeter, depending on the application. This innovative approach provides substantial advantages in manufacturing pharmaceutical formulations, especially when dealing with sensitive macromolecules like proteins or DNA.
